Woodchopping is a popular activity that involves chopping wood into pieces. It is a useful skill for outdoor enthusiasts and people who rely on wood as a source of heating. However, woodchopping can also be called by various other synonyms such as firewood chopping, tree felling, timber cutting, axe work, timber harvesting, log splitting, lumberjacking, woodcutting, and forestry. Each of these synonyms describes a similar activity that involves cutting, splitting, or chopping wood into usable pieces. Overall, whether you call it woodchopping, timber cutting, or any of the other synonyms, it's a necessary skill that's been done for centuries to utilize wood as a natural resource.
